Share via


Structuur CDaoParameterInfo

Opmerking

De Microsoft Foundation Classes-bibliotheek (MFC) wordt nog steeds ondersteund. We voegen echter geen functies meer toe of werken de documentatie bij.

De CDaoParameterInfo structuur bevat informatie over een parameterobject dat is gedefinieerd voor DATA Access Objects (DAO).

Opmerking

Data Access Object (DAO) wordt ondersteund via Office 2013. DAO 3.6 is de definitieve versie en is verouderd.

Syntaxis

struct CDaoParameterInfo
{
    CString m_strName;       // Primary
    short m_nType;           // Primary
    ColeVariant m_varValue;  // Secondary
};

Parameterwaarden

m_strName
Noem het parameterobject een unieke naam. Zie het onderwerp 'Naameigenschap' in DAO Help voor meer informatie.

m_nType
Een waarde die het gegevenstype van een parameterobject aangeeft. Zie het m_nType lid van de structuur CDaoFieldInfo voor een lijst met mogelijke waarden. Zie het onderwerp 'Eigenschap type' in DAO Help voor meer informatie.

m_varValue
De waarde van de parameter, opgeslagen in een COleVariant-object .

Opmerkingen

De verwijzingen naar primair en secundair hierboven geven aan hoe de informatie wordt geretourneerd door de functie GetParameterInfo-lid in klasse CDaoQueryDef.

De Microsoft Foundation Classes (MFC) bevatten geen DAO-parameterobjecten in een klasse. DAO querydef-objecten onderliggende MFC-objecten CDaoQueryDef slaan parameters op in hun parametersverzamelingen. Als u toegang wilt krijgen tot de parameterobjecten in een CDaoQueryDef-object , roept u de lidfunctie van GetParameterInfo het querydef-object aan voor een bepaalde parameternaam of een index in de verzameling Parameters. U kunt de functie CDaoQueryDef::GetParameterCount-lid gebruiken in combinatie met GetParameterInfo het doorlopen van de verzameling Parameters.

Informatie die wordt opgehaald door de CDaoQueryDef::GetParameterInfo-lidfunctie wordt opgeslagen in een CDaoParameterInfo structuur. Aanroep GetParameterInfo voor het querydef-object in wiens parametersverzameling het parameterobject wordt opgeslagen.

Opmerking

Als u alleen de waarde van een parameter wilt ophalen of instellen, gebruikt u de lidfuncties GetParamValue en SetParamValue van klasse CDaoRecordset.

CDaoParameterInfo definieert ook een Dump lidfunctie in builds voor foutopsporing. U kunt Dump de inhoud van een CDaoParameterInfo object dumpen.

Requirements

Rubriek:afxdao.h

Zie ook

Structuren, stijlen, callbacks en berichttoewijzingen
CDaoQueryDef-klasse